How to get there

How to Reach La Tallada D'emporda in Spain

La Tallada D'emporda is a beautiful village located in the province of Girona, Catalonia, Spain. If you are planning to visit this charming destination, here are a few ways to reach La Tallada D'emporda:

By Air:

The nearest airport to La Tallada D'emporda is Girona-Costa Brava Airport, which is approximately 45 kilometers away. From the airport, you can hire a taxi or rent a car to reach the village. Alternatively, you can also take a bus or a train from Girona city to La Tallada D'emporda.

By Train:

If you prefer traveling by train, the closest railway station to La Tallada D'emporda is Flaçà. From there, you can either take a taxi or a local bus to reach the village. Trains from major cities in Spain, such as Barcelona, connect to Flaçà, making it a convenient option for travelers.

By Car:

If you enjoy road trips and prefer the flexibility of driving, you can reach La Tallada D'emporda by car. The village is well-connected by roads, and you can follow the AP-7 highway if you are coming from Barcelona or Girona. The journey offers scenic views of the Catalan countryside.

By Bus:

There are regular bus services available from Girona city to La Tallada D'emporda. The journey takes approximately one hour, and it is a cost-effective option for travelers. You can check the bus schedules and book your tickets in advance to ensure a smooth journey.

By Bicycle:

If you are an avid cyclist or enjoy exploring the countryside on two wheels, you can consider cycling to La Tallada D'emporda. The village is surrounded by picturesque landscapes and offers cycling routes for enthusiasts. Make sure to plan your route and carry necessary equipment for a safe and enjoyable journey.

Getting to know La Tallada D'emporda

La Tallada d'Empordà is a picturesque village nestled in the heart of Spain, known for its stunning natural beauty and rich cultural heritage. Located in the province of Girona, in the Catalonia region, La Tallada d'Empordà offers visitors a chance to escape the hustle and bustle of city life and immerse themselves in a tranquil and idyllic setting.

With its charming medieval architecture and narrow cobblestone streets, the village exudes an old-world charm that is hard to resist. Visitors can explore the well-preserved historic buildings, including the Church of Sant Pere de Tallada and the Castle of Canapost, which offer a glimpse into the village's fascinating past.

Surrounded by rolling hills and lush green landscapes, La Tallada d'Empordà is a paradise for nature lovers. The area is dotted with vineyards and olive groves, providing ample opportunities for scenic walks or bike rides. The stunning beaches of the Costa Brava are just a short drive away, offering a perfect retreat for those seeking sun, sand, and sea.

The village also boasts a vibrant cultural scene, with a number of cultural events and festivals held throughout the year. Visitors can experience traditional music and dance performances, sample local delicacies at the village markets, or participate in wine tastings at the local wineries.
